> I'm trying to print a list of localized month names in my rails app. I
> set my locale to it-IT, created an it-IT.yml translation file with the
> translated month names, but it doesn't seem to work.
>
> When I use date_select I can see the trasnlated months, therefore my
> yml
> file and my locale should be ok, but when I try something like
> Date.new(2008).strftime("%B") or Date::MONTHNAMES i always get the
> english month names.
>
Date's strftime & Date's MONTHNAME constants just aren't localized
(I18n.localize has a localized strftime for you)
